Output ef7b31837d8b1a7a1bb777e05f95bd852e188e2c827e7d6f72173fb6e0846593:51

value
401497000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4b50cefe044f65ad8abd45b8ddee48e455f357 OP_EQUAL
address
3HJjhNSS5jDMrXGc1fNLQuVHaFfUS6iHBW
transaction
ef7b31837d8b1a7a1bb777e05f95bd852e188e2c827e7d6f72173fb6e0846593
spent
true